Checkout Layout Shift Elimination
We audit every CLS event in your checkout flow — the DOM elements that shift position as the page loads and cause buyers to tap the wrong thing at the critical moment. Payment selectors, trust badges, shipping calculators, upsell injections — each is tested across devices and browsers, fixed at the code level, and verified against a CLS target of 0. We document every change with before/after CLS measurements so you can see exactly what was stabilised.

Script Conflict Resolution
Every third-party app in your checkout is audited for conflict behaviour. We identify scripts that load out of sequence, scripts that compete for the same DOM nodes, and scripts that produce intermittent failures on specific browsers or devices. Conflicts are resolved through script deferral, load-order correction, or surgical removal of scripts that produce no measurable conversion benefit. Every resolution is tested across iOS Safari, Chrome mobile, and desktop.

Mobile Funnel Rebuild
We rebuild the mobile friction architecture of your store's conversion funnel — from product page to order confirmation. Tap targets are corrected to minimum 44px. Variant selectors are rebuilt for thumb navigation. Sticky add-to-cart behaviour is implemented where CVR data supports it. Quantity selectors are fixed for one-handed use. The goal is a mobile funnel where every interaction that matters is frictionless on a 375px viewport with one thumb.

High Shopify checkout abandonment is almost always caused by technical friction, not design or copy. The most common causes are: layout shifts during checkout that cause accidental taps on the wrong elements, conflicting third-party scripts that cause intermittent failures on iOS Safari (affecting 40–60% of mobile buyer traffic), slow checkout load time that breaks purchase momentum, and payment selector bugs that appear on specific devices. These issues look like voluntary abandonment in your analytics — they're invisible without a code-level audit.

Checkout friction mapping is the process of identifying every technical and UX barrier that prevents a high-intent buyer from completing a purchase once they've reached checkout. At Webulux, this combines heatmap analysis at the checkout stage, session recording review of abandonment events, JavaScript error monitoring during checkout, cross-browser testing (especially iOS Safari vs Chrome), CLS measurement per checkout element, and funnel drop-off analysis tied to specific device/browser combinations. The output is a map of every friction point with an estimated monthly revenue cost per issue.
